Conscious Business: How to Build Value Through Values

Conscious Business

Conscious Business: How to Build Value Through Values is a 2002 book by Fred Kofman.

1 recommender
Sheryl Sandberg

“This book had a profound effect on my career and life. I think about his lessons almost every day — the importance of authentic communication, impeccable commitments, being a player, not a victim, and taking responsibility.”  – Sheryl Sandberg
